Jimmy Kimmel made a triumphant return to late-night television, attracting 6.3 million viewers on ABC and generating significant buzz on social media. His comeback follows a brief hiatus due to controversial remarks about right-wing activist Charlie Kirk, making this episode particularly noteworthy. Kimmel's ability to draw such a large audience highlights his enduring popularity and the public's interest in his take on current events, reinforcing the importance of late-night shows in shaping cultural conversations.
